Review:
Based on the 17th century Scottish Renaissance carol, this selection, which is scored in C Major, may also be titled "Celtic Rejoicing." An optional tambour/tambourine part may be played to add ambiance. At 33 measures, this makes a good opening piece for concert or a brief moment in Christmas worship, perhaps between readings.
